I just bought a new Gateway PC with Vista. Installed the game and was cranked to play on this new PC. Funny thing is I can not take off as the shift/+ will not work. I checked and my settings are correct for the game as they are defualt. Anyone else having this issue with Vista?
-
If you have a throttle (joystick lever or mouse wheel) I believe the throttle keys on the keyboard become null.
If you're using the mouse wheel or stick lever as throttle, check that they are calibrated in game. You may not be getting the full range of motion to get max function with them if they are not calibrated.
